Don’t Skip “Iron Man” End Credits – Samuel L. Jackson’s Nick Fury To Make Appearance

By Jason on May 1, 2008

This news is hot off the press. It’s been reported that Samuel L. Jackson’s character from Iron Man, Nick Fury was cut from the film in the final edit. However, Moviehole has confirmed that Nick Fury will, in fact, be making an appearance in Iron Man after all. But he won’t be making that appearance until after the credits for the film.
